Dependant on how often you fly, if you inform your current life insurance company, that you are undertaking this pursuit, they may not charge you any extra. Check with your flying school if they offer insurance as well. If you declare the pursuit they are under an obligation within the terms of your insurance. (It may be different in Eire)
